Output 34d513500975761c5feebbb54bb3a84ab66e432d3708fb36e7283d7e1871ca26:18

value
2636137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f8989bc1e19ddbfe120275444ff337949cbf862 OP_EQUAL
address
3GEa8MWX1eNrHSxuoCXUdpMpRYqqCVMb6q
transaction
34d513500975761c5feebbb54bb3a84ab66e432d3708fb36e7283d7e1871ca26
spent
true